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000699581.1(OSTM1):​c.-40+10081C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0224 in 152,242 control chromosomes in the GnomAD database, including 119 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

OSTM1 (HGNC:21652): (osteoclastogenesis associated transmembrane protein 1) This gene encodes a protein that may be involved in the degradation of G proteins via the ubiquitin-dependent proteasome pathway. The encoded protein binds to members of subfamily A of the regulator of the G-protein signaling (RGS) family through an N-terminal leucine-rich region. This protein also has a central RING finger-like domain and E3 ubiquitin ligase activity. This protein is highly conserved from flies to humans. Defects in this gene may cause the autosomal recessive, infantile malignant form of osteopetrosis. [provided by RefSeq, Jul 2008]
